Acrylic tubs are relatively delicate and can be affected from dropped tiles while tiling. In some cases a shower door to fall and cause a visible indentation. The perimeter of the tub can crack if too much weight is put on it or experiences force when adjusting surrounding tiles. Many times, an acrylic tub gets harmed during transportation.

Upon arrival, we dust sheet the ground surface, WC, washbasin, radiators, and major fixtures.
We meticulously scrub the bath with specific cleaners and get rid of deteriorated caulking around the tub.
We handle all bath surface repairs, such as small fractures and surface chips, surface marks, limescale, and erosion caused by minerals in water. Should your bathtub have structural issues, we reinforce and fix it completely.
We cover the tiles, walls, taps, drain area, and overflow drain with specialized covering materials to ensure no overspray affects them.
We use a high-strength degreasing solution to get rid of oil residues, surface contaminants, impurities and stains.
Then we spray on the second bonding agent with a hot air gun. Unlike other bath re enamelling companies we use two bonding agents so the enamel surface we spray on has a very strong hold to the original surface.
Following that, we coat the surface with the second bonding agent using high-temperature application.Where others may stop at one bonding layer, our process includes a double-bonding system, so the enamel surface we spray on firmly adheres for long-lasting results.
We employ an professional-grade heat-curing process to cure the new enamel and take off the protective coverings.
Next, our experts apply expert refinements, buffing, refining, and perfecting the surface to make sure it’s perfect.
We then carefully apply a protective waterproof sealant so the surface is watertight and secure.

This is due to our expertise to identify underlying problems that may not be obvious.In the production process of cast iron and steel baths, it is finished with an exceptionally tough and robust layer of enamel.
This enamel coating is applied through high-temperature fusion in an intense heating process and solidifies as it cools to result in a sleek, polished look.Definitely!
